VPS (Virtual Private Server) hosting gives you a virtualised server environment within a larger physical server. You get dedicated portions of resources (CPU, RAM, disk) and more control compared to shared hosting.
With VPS, you have guaranteed resources and less contention from other users. You also typically have more control, including choosing OS, installing custom software, and root access (depending on plan). It sits between shared and dedicated hosting in terms of power, cost, and complexity.
Yes — most VPS plans give you full root (or sudo) access so you can install, configure, and manage services as needed.
It depends on the plan. Some VPS plans are fully managed (the host handles OS updates, security patches, backups, monitoring), while others are unmanaged or lightly managed (you handle most of the server-level tasks).

Yes — VPS allows you to host multiple domains, web applications, databases, and services (web servers, mail servers, etc.) just like a dedicated server (within your resource limits).
If you exceed CPU, memory, or disk I/O limits, performance may be throttled or processes may be killed. It’s best to monitor usage and upgrade before limits become problematic.
